Chapter Eleven
Vash sighed as he over looked the small town below. Had it really been three years since he had last been here?
"I wonder what's changed."
Beside him Knives snorted and crossed his arms. "Well you aren't going to find out by just standing here."
Vash sent his brother a sideways glare before he took a deep breath and squared his shoulders.
"Well…here I go…"
The town was basically as he remembered if only a little larger. It seems that the population had expanded a bit since he had left.
"I'll bet the insurance girls have a lot of business now." He said with a small smile. "I wonder where they are…"
The most logical place for him to start would be at their house which he quickly ruled out when he saw it darkened with the windows and door boarded up. Apprehension made his stomach flip in a way that made him feel queasy but he laughed it off.
"Well it has been a long time. They probably just moved to a new place that's all." Vash nodded firmly to himself while Knives watched from a few yarz back. "I'll just ask around. Someone will know where they are."
It took him several unsuccessful attempts and unfamiliar faces before he finally found someone he recognized, feeling certain that he would be able to enlighten him in his search.
"Hey Kyle! Long time no see!"
Kyle spun around quickly at the familiar voice and Vash felt his heart skip a beat as he watched the color drop rapidly from the other man's face.
"Vash the Stampede…It's…been a while…"
"Yeah, it has," Vash said, more reserved then before. "I had some pretty important things that I needed to sort out before I came back."
"I-I see…"
"Look, I'm sure you know why I stopped you." Vash said with a smile. "So if you could just tell me where they are I'll let you get back to your afternoon."
Kyle didn't meet Vash's eye as he awkwardly shuffled his feet. "I-I'm not sure I know what you're talking about. Who are you looking for?"
Vash's eyebrows furrowed in confusion. "The insurance girls of course."
"Who?"
Irritation began to show on his face as Vash lifted his arm, palm down, to the middle of his chest.
"Short one with dark hair." He raised his arm to his shoulder. "And a taller one with light brown hair."
"S-sorry Vash," Kyle said, still not looking up. "I-I'm still not sure who you mean."
"Millie and Meryl!" He said as he grasped the man's collar. "Where are they Kyle? I know that you know!"
Kyle flinched before he let out a small sigh. "Well…I do…and I don't…"
The blood in Vash's veins ran cold as his fingers tightened. "What are you talking about?"
"…It weren't long after you left. Maybe a month or two…" Kyle looked up with pleading eyes. "You gotta believe me Vash. I didn't mean for it to happen, I swear. It was an accident."
"What happened Kyle?" Vash asked, his voice wavering. "Where are they?"
"No one's really sure. Like I was saying, a few months after you left there was a fight in the streets and…they got hurt. Real bad from what I could tell. This lady came and took'em saying she was a nurse. No one ever saw'em again. Everyone figures that they…well…"
Fifty emotions seemed to bombard him at once as Vash's grip on Kyle's collar grew slack allowing the shorter man to slip free. Kyle watched on in apprehension as he watched the expression in Vash's eyes change rapidly from shock to denial to pain and to anguish before it they finally settled on freezing over with rage.
"Who did it?" Vash asked, his voice frigid. "Who was responsible Kyle?"
Kyle trembled from head to foot as he spoke up again. "It was an accident Vash. I-I…The gun went off…I-I didn't think that the guy would actually try to shoot me. And none of us expected the girls to somehow end up in the way…"
By now Vash was trembling as well, but he was trembling from rage. For the first time in his life, he actually felt the need to seek revenge…
"What makes it worse was the kids," Kyle said with a sigh. "Miss Millie was so excited as she told me that she and Miss Meryl were both expecting. That came as a real surprise to us all…"
Vash froze.
"What did you say?"
Kyle looked up. "I-I said that Miss Millie surprised me when she said that Miss Meryl was expecting…"
"Expecting…" Vash said. "Expecting…a baby?"
Kyle nodded. "Didn't you know Vash? Millie said the baby was yours."
"Mine…" Vash said slowly. "Mine….Meryl was…and it was…"
His eyes widened as he remembered that time so long ago when he felt a surge of unfamiliar pain.
The baby. It was the baby's pain…His child had been in pain….
His child…Meryl…they were dead.
Unable to hold it in any longer Vash collapsed to his knees and screamed; his palms guarding his face as he wept.
End Chapter Eleven
